The Olympus Stylus 500 is as compact point-and-shoot camera that looks good, resists water, is super-fast, and has some neat features. Unfortunately photo quality isn’t as good as it should be. But first, the good news. This latest Stylus is compact (but not too much so), metal, and weatherproof. It can get a little wet, but that doesn’t mean it can go snorkeling with you — for that you’ll need the optional underwater case. The Stylus has a large and sharp 2.5″ LCD display that is viewable in both bright and dim lighting. Camera performance is very good for the most part, especially the startup speed — wow. The camera doesn’t have any manual controls, but you’ll find plenty of scene modes to make up for it. Other nice features include in-camera cropping, special effects, and albums.
